HONEY BOURBON CHICKEN POPS



Honey Bourbon Chicken Pops image

Provided by Jeff Mauro, host of Sandwich King

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 pounds chicken drumsticks
1 cup store-bought or homemade BBQ rub
Honey Bourbon Glaze, recipe follows
1/2 cup bourbon
1/2 cup ketchup
1/3 cup apple cider vinegar
1/4 cup honey
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
2 tablespoons dark brown s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at a grill or smoker to 375 degrees F. (If using wood, I love cherry or apple wood.)
  • Lop off about 1/4 inch from the top of a drumstick, and from the tip of the handle of the drumstick, using dry hands and a dry knife. (This way, you can stand them up straight, and it makes pulling the meat up easier.) About an inch up from end of the handle, where the bulb meets the handle, make a sharp cut that goes all the way around the handle (a 360-degree cut), making sure to cut through the skin, muscle and tendons. Push the meat up to the more bulbous end of the leg and remove the little bit of meat on the handle end. Repeat with the remaining drumsticks.
  • Place the rub in a small sheet pan or flat dish and roll each drumstick in the rub. Place the drumsticks directly on the grill and cook, rotating a couple times throughout, until the internal temperature registers 165 degrees F, 20 to 30 minutes.
  • Dunk each drumstick into the Glaze and stand up on the grill until the sauce is caramelized and set, another 10 to 12 minutes.
  • Combine in the bourbon, ketchup, vinegar, honey, mustard and brown sugar in a small saucepot and simmer for 10 minutes.

BOURBON MOLASSES DRUMSTICKS



Bourbon Molasses Drumsticks image

Plan ahead the sauce needs to be made 1 day ahead and chilled...I strongly suggest to double this recipe, or at least double up on the sauce, it's really good!

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Chicken Thigh & Leg

Time P1DT30m

Yield 10 drumsticks

Number Of Ingredients 16

10 chicken drumsticks
seasoning salt (or use white salt)
black pepper
1/4 cup butter
1 medium onion, finely chopped
2 tablespoons fresh minced garlic (or to taste)
2 teaspoons dryed chili flakes (optional or to taste)
1 cup ketchup
1/4 cup molasses
2 tablespoons brown sugar, packed
1 1/2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
1 tablespoon prepared yellow mustard
1 teaspoon black pepper
2 teaspoons chili powder (or to taste)
1/4 cup jack daniel's Bourbon
salt

Steps:

  • For the sauce; melt the butter in a saucepan over medium heat; add in the onion and dryed chili flakes (if using) saute for about 5 minutes (adding in the garlic the last 2 minutes).
  • Add in the ketchup,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, mustard, black pepper and chili powder; mix to combine and simmer for about 20 minutes.
  • Add in the bourbon and cook until heated through for about 3 minutes.
  • Season with salt to taste.
  • Cool and chill the sauce overnight.
  • Prepare the grill to medium heat.
  • Season the drumsticks with seasoning salt and pepper.
  • Transfer about 1/2 cup BBQ sauce to a small bowl and reserve for basting.
  • Grill the drumsticks turning to cook on all sides (about 25 minutes).
  • Brush with BBQ glaze the last 3-4 minutes of cooking.
  • Transfer the drumsticks to a platter and serve with remaining sauce.
  • Delicious!
